Rezumat | ||||||
During recent years biotechnological methods and, particularly, in vitro techniques have acquired more and more significance in different fields of life. The aim of this study was to elaborate the in vitro technologies for different species of medicinal plants. The results obtained in our investigations showed a significant effect of medium composition, the nature and physiological state of initial explants. On the basis of the conducted researchthe optimal chemical and physical conditions of in vitro cultivation were developed. The possibility was shown of the elaborated techniques application for producing new source vegetal material, preservation and micropropagation of valuable elite plants, obtaining virus free plants, producing biologically active substances in callus cultures of medicinal plants. |
